Let’s talk about the “C” word—cellulite.
If you’ve ever looked in the mirror and noticed dimples on your thighs or butt, trust me, you’re in very good company. Nearly 90% of women will have cellulite at some point in their lives. It’s incredibly common, and despite what social media would have you believe, it happens to women of every age, shape, and fitness level.
One of the biggest misconceptions is that cellulite only affects people who don’t exercise or eat well. That’s simply not true. Even celebrities, professional athletes, and supermodels have cellulite. The difference? Many of their photos are professionally lit, edited, retouched, or filtered before you ever see them.
So don’t be too hard on yourself.
While there’s no magic cure, there are several things you can do to help improve the appearance of cellulite and support healthier-looking skin.
Dry Brush Before You Shower
One of my favorite self-care rituals is dry brushing. Before you hop in the shower, gently brush your skin in upward circular motions. It feels amazing, boosts circulation, lightly exfoliates your skin, and may temporarily improve the appearance of cellulite.
Put Your Coffee to Work
Coffee isn’t just for your morning pick-me-up.
Caffeine can temporarily tighten the skin and increase circulation. Instead of throwing away your used coffee grounds, mix them with a little coconut oil to create an easy DIY body scrub. Your skin will feel incredibly soft afterward.
Roll It Out
A cellulite massage roller is another great tool to keep at home. It helps stimulate circulation, loosen tight tissue, and temporarily smooth the appearance of dimples. Plus, it feels like giving your legs a mini spa treatment.
Try Lymphatic Massage
I’m a big believer in lymphatic drainage massage. It helps encourage healthy circulation, reduce fluid retention, and leaves your skin looking smoother and feeling refreshed. If regular appointments aren’t practical, there are wonderful at-home tools that can give you many of the same benefits.
Dance More
Here’s one of the easiest tips…
Turn on your favorite music and dance.
Movement is one of the best things you can do for your circulation, your muscles, your mood, and your overall health. The bonus? It’s fun, and it never feels like exercise.
Explore Laser Treatments
Today’s technology offers more options than ever before. Certain laser and radiofrequency treatments can stimulate collagen production and improve the appearance of cellulite over time. If you’re considering professional treatments, talk with a qualified skincare or medical professional to determine what may be right for you.
Give Your Skin a Vitamin C Boost
Vitamin C is wonderful for healthy skin. One simple DIY exfoliating scrub combines fresh lemon juice with a little sugar to gently buff away dry skin, leaving your body feeling smoother and brighter.
Feed Your Skin From the Inside Out
Beautiful skin starts with good nutrition.
Fill your plate with colorful berries, leafy greens, healthy fats like salmon and avocado, nuts, and plenty of water. Staying hydrated helps your skin look healthier, while nutrient-rich foods support collagen production and overall skin health.
